Navigating Sharjah's Industrial Transport Regulations

Operating staff transport in Sharjah requires strict adherence to the Sharjah Roads and Transport Authority (SRTA) guidelines. Unlike private transport, commercial worker transport must meet specific safety benchmarks, including speed limiters set to 80 km/h or 100 km/h depending on the vehicle type, and regular mechanical inspections to ensure roadworthiness in the harsh UAE climate.

JMT Group ensures that every vehicle in our fleet is fully compliant with these regional mandates. Our drivers undergo rigorous training to handle the heavy traffic conditions common on the E311 (Sheikh Mohammed Bin Zayed Road) and E611 (Emirates Road), which are the primary arteries connecting worker accommodations in areas like Muwaileh to the industrial zones.

Furthermore, we ensure all documentation, including comprehensive insurance for all passengers and valid permits for entering free zones like Hamriyah, are always up to date. This proactive compliance prevents costly fines and operational delays for your business.

Fleet Options for Industrial Scale

Every factory has different needs based on shift sizes and accommodation proximity. For smaller specialized teams or supervisory staff, our 14-seater or 30-seater Coasters offer a nimble solution that can navigate narrower industrial streets more efficiently than larger coaches.

For bulk labour transport, the 66-seater non-AC or AC buses remain the most cost-effective choice. These 'labour buses' are designed for durability and high-frequency use. However, we are seeing an increasing trend in 2026 where factories opt for our 50-seater luxury coaches for long-distance commutes, such as transporting workers residing in Ajman or Umm Al Quwain to Sharjah-based facilities.

All our buses are equipped with heavy-duty air conditioning systems, an absolute necessity given that summer temperatures in Sharjah can frequently exceed 45 degrees Celsius. Ensuring worker comfort during the commute is a proven factor in reducing heat-related fatigue on the factory floor.

Cost Analysis: AED Pricing for Sharjah Staff Transport

Budgeting for staff transport is a critical component of operational overheads. In the Sharjah market, pricing varies based on the contract duration, the number of trips per day, and the total distance covered. Generally, a monthly contract for a 30-seater bus within Sharjah industrial zones can range from AED 6,000 to AED 9,000, while 66-seater buses may range from AED 8,500 to AED 12,500 per month.

For factories operating 24/7 with three distinct shifts, JMT Group offers 'double-shift' or 'triple-shift' packages. These are significantly more economical than booking individual trips, as they maximize the utility of a single vehicle and driver team allocated to your specific account.

Strategic Route Planning for Al Sajaa and Hamriyah

The geography of Sharjah’s industrial sector is vast. The Al Sajaa Industrial Area, for instance, has seen massive expansion recently, requiring precise route planning to avoid the bottlenecks at the intersection of the E88. Our operations team uses real-time traffic monitoring to advise drivers on the best routes, ensuring punctuality even during peak rush hours.

We also specialize in transport for the Hamriyah Free Zone. Entry into the free zone requires specific gate passes and security clearances for both the vehicle and the driver.
